Questions & Answers

What companies run services between São Paulo, Brazil and Gama, Brazil?

Gol Transportes Aéreos, Azul, and LATAM Chile fly from São Paulo–Congonhas Airport (CGH) to Brasilia International Airport (BSB) hourly. Alternatively, Real Maia operates a bus from Tietê Bus Terminal to Terminal Rodoviário de Brasília every 4 hours. Tickets cost R$370–650 and the journey takes 17h 3m. Two other operators also service this route.
